The bundled alibaba plugin registers a video-generation provider for Wan models on Alibaba Model Studio (the international name for DashScope). It is enabled by default; only an API key is needed.

Property Value
Provider id alibaba
Plugin bundled, enabledByDefault: true
Auth env vars MODELSTUDIO_API_KEYDASHSCOPE_API_KEYQWEN_API_KEY (first match wins)
Onboarding flag --auth-choice alibaba-model-studio-api-key
Direct CLI flag --alibaba-model-studio-api-key <key>
Default model alibaba/wan2.6-t2v
Default base URL https://dashscope-intl.aliyuncs.com

Getting started

Store the key against the `alibaba` provider through onboarding:
```bash
openclaw onboard --auth-choice alibaba-model-studio-api-key
```

Or pass the key directly:

```bash
openclaw onboard --alibaba-model-studio-api-key <your-key>
```

Or export one of the accepted env vars before starting the Gateway:

```bash
export MODELSTUDIO_API_KEY=sk-...
# or DASHSCOPE_API_KEY=...
# or QWEN_API_KEY=...
```
```json5 { agents: { defaults: { videoGenerationModel: { primary: "alibaba/wan2.6-t2v", }, }, }, } ``` ```bash openclaw models list --provider alibaba ```
The list includes all five bundled Wan models. If `MODELSTUDIO_API_KEY` cannot be resolved, `openclaw models status --json` reports the missing credential under `auth.unusableProfiles`.
The Alibaba plugin and the [Qwen plugin](/providers/qwen) both authenticate against DashScope and accept overlapping env vars. Use `alibaba/...` model ids for the dedicated Wan video surface; use `qwen/...` ids for Qwen chat, embedding, or media-understanding.

Built-in Wan models

Model ref Mode
alibaba/wan2.6-t2v Text-to-video (default)
alibaba/wan2.6-i2v Image-to-video
alibaba/wan2.6-r2v Reference-to-video
alibaba/wan2.6-r2v-flash Reference-to-video (fast)
alibaba/wan2.7-r2v Reference-to-video

Capabilities and limits

All three modes share the same per-request video count and duration cap; only the input shape differs.

Mode Max output videos Max input images Max input videos Max duration Supported controls
Text-to-video 1 n/a n/a 10 s size, aspectRatio, resolution, audio, watermark
Image-to-video 1 1 n/a 10 s size, aspectRatio, resolution, audio, watermark
Reference-to-video 1 n/a 4 10 s size, aspectRatio, resolution, audio, watermark

A request that omits durationSeconds gets DashScope's accepted default of 5 seconds. Set durationSeconds explicitly on the video generation tool to extend up to 10 s.

Reference image and video inputs must be remote `http(s)` URLs; DashScope's reference modes reject local file paths. Upload to object storage first, or use the [media tool](/tools/media-overview) flow that already produces a public URL.

Advanced configuration

The provider defaults to the international DashScope endpoint. To target the China-region endpoint:
```json5
{
  models: {
    providers: {
      alibaba: {
        baseUrl: "https://dashscope.aliyuncs.com",
      },
    },
  },
}
```

The provider strips trailing slashes before constructing AIGC task URLs.
OpenClaw resolves the Alibaba API key from environment variables in this order, taking the first non-empty value:
1. `MODELSTUDIO_API_KEY`
2. `DASHSCOPE_API_KEY`
3. `QWEN_API_KEY`

Configured `auth.profiles` entries (set via `openclaw models auth login`) override env-var resolution. See [Auth profiles in the models FAQ](/help/faq-models#auth-profiles-what-they-are-and-how-to-manage-them) for profile rotation, cooldown, and override mechanics.
Both bundled plugins talk to DashScope and accept overlapping API keys. Use:
- `alibaba/wan*.*` ids for the dedicated Wan video provider documented on this page.
- `qwen/*` ids for Qwen chat, embedding, and media understanding (see [Qwen](/providers/qwen)).

Setting `MODELSTUDIO_API_KEY` once authenticates both plugins, since the auth env var list intentionally overlaps; onboarding each plugin separately is not required.
